My daughter broke both scaphoid bones

I needed two simultaneously going at night on the wrists over both fiberglass casts . I bought a9 and m1 initially and then got a p9 just to have protocol options on both wrists. … Now she has m1 and p9 and I’m using a9 on my back heh heh.

Any tips?

Looks like you have a good plan.

One thing that I find very useful is to use ice pack wraps to hold M1/A9/P9 in place on arm and leg positions.

I got this one last week from amazon:

This is a cheap simple one with two pockets to hold ice packs. I had a nagging knee injury, and it worked perfectly.

The way to use these is to just remove the ice pack and put your A9/M1/P9 in the empty pocket where the ice pack was.

For your daughter’s wrists, you could try this one:

Same brand as the knee wrap I just got, and it is built the same way, so it will probably work perfectly.

Let me know if you try it and how well it works.

Thank you @Bob for your response and suggestions

I’ve since purchased arm band phone jogging holders to hold the m1/p9. For the m1 I’m using a mini USB cable connected to a mini charger brick that doesn’t auto shutdown with low current draw. Everything fits in there with excess coil cables tucked in. Then I wrap it around her casts and it’s super tidy for bed time . I use vet tape to secure the coils around her scaphoid sandwich style.
